Shoestring Budget 7-Day Itinerary in Japan

Viewed by 86 travelers
Wednesday January 24: Explore Tokyo

Morning: Start your trip in Tokyo by visiting the iconic Senso-ji Temple in Asakusa. Marvel at the beautiful architecture and immerse yourself in the bustling atmosphere of the Nakamise Shopping Street. Afternoon: Head to Ueno Park and visit the Tokyo National Museum to learn about Japan's rich cultural heritage. In the evening, explore the vibrant nightlife of Shibuya Crossing, known for its neon lights and trendy shops.

  • Senso-ji Temple: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Tokyo National Museum: Estimated Cost - 620 yen,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Shibuya Crossing: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Thursday January 25: Discover Kyoto

Morning: Take a bullet train from Tokyo to Kyoto and start your day with a visit to the breathtaking Kinkaku-ji Temple, also known as the Golden Pavilion. Afternoon: Explore the historic district of Higashiyama and stroll along the picturesque streets lined with traditional wooden houses. In the evening, experience a traditional tea ceremony in one of Kyoto's tea houses.

  • Kinkaku-ji Temple: Estimated Cost - 400 yen,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Higashiyama District: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 3-4 hours
  • Traditional Tea Ceremony: Estimated Cost - 1,500-3,000 yen,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Friday January 26: Visit Osaka

Morning: Take a short train ride from Kyoto to Osaka and start your day by exploring the vibrant Dotonbori district. Try local street food and admire the famous Glico Running Man billboard. Afternoon: Visit Osaka Castle and learn about Japan's history while enjoying panoramic views from the top. In the evening, experience the bustling nightlife of Namba.

  • Dotonbori District: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Osaka Castle: Estimated Cost - 600 yen,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Namba: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day January 27: Explore Nara

Morning: Take a short train ride from Osaka to Nara and visit Nara Park, home to friendly deer and the famous Todai-ji Temple. Afternoon: Explore the charming streets of Naramachi, a preserved traditional district. Don't miss the Nara National Museum to see exquisite Buddhist art. In the evening, enjoy a peaceful stroll around Kasuga Taisha Shrine.

  • Nara Park: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Naramachi: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Nara National Museum: Estimated Cost - 520 yen,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Sunday January 28: Experience Hiroshima

Morning: Take a bullet train from Osaka to Hiroshima and start your day by visiting the Hiroshima Peace Memorial Park, dedicated to the atomic bombing in 1945. Afternoon: Explore the stunning Itsukushima Shrine on Miyajima Island, known for its floating torii gate. In the evening, enjoy local delicacies in Hiroshima's Okonomimura, a multi-level building filled with delicious Hiroshima-style okonomiyaki restaurants.

  • Hiroshima Peace Memorial Park: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Itsukushima Shrine: Estimated Cost - 300 yen,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Okonomimura: Estimated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Monday January 29: Discover Himeji

Morning: Take a train from Hiroshima to Himeji and visit Himeji Castle, one of Japan's most iconic castles. Afternoon: Explore the beautiful Kokoen Garden adjacent to the castle and experience the tranquility of Japanese gardens. In the evening, stroll along the shopping streets of Himeji and try local delicacies like Himeji-style yakitori.

  • Himeji Castle: Estimated Cost - 1,000 yen,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Kokoen Garden: Estimated Cost - 310 yen,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Himeji Shopping Streets: Estimated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Tuesday January 30: Return to Tokyo

Morning: Take a bullet train from Himeji to Tokyo. Visit the vibrant neighborhoods of Harajuku and Takeshita Street, famous for their quirky fashion and street food. Afternoon: Spend your last day exploring the upscale shopping district of Ginza and indulge in Japanese cuisine. In the evening, take a relaxing walk through the beautiful gardens of the Imperial Palace.

  • Harajuku and Takeshita Street: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Ginza: Estimated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Imperial Palace Gardens: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While visiting Japan on a shoestring budget, consider exploring the hidden gems and local favorites. In Tokyo, venture off the beaten path to Yanaka, a traditional neighborhood with narrow streets, old houses, and peaceful temples. In Kyoto, visit Fushimi Inari Taisha, known for its thousands of vermillion torii gates. In Osaka, explore the vibrant Shinsekai district, famous for its nostalgic atmosphere and delicious kushikatsu. Take a day trip from Tokyo to the charming town of Kamakura to visit the Great Buddha and enjoy the coastal scenery. These attractions offer unique experiences without breaking the bank.
